Somewhere along the way, someone tried Mobil 1 ATF (which happens to meet Mercon specs) with friction modifier and discovered that synthetic oil was beneficial.
This is what I did on my 3rd MTX fluid change, but I added Mopar friction modifier (its all the guy had in stock) I did that about 6K ago and no problems at all. FWIW, I changed my car over to Mobil 1 ATF at 6K, then changed it out again at 26K and the last one was at 45K, but like I said earlier, I added the Mopar friction modifier I paid about $15.00 for (3) quarts of Mobil 1, $8.00 for the Mopar friction modifier and $10.00 for the change out. I feel this is cheap preventive maintence
